How they compare
Palau currently reports 0.0033 t per person against 0.0031 t per person in Azerbaijan, a difference of 0.0002 t per person.
That makes Palau's figure about 1.1 times Azerbaijan's.
The two have swapped places 4 times across 32 shared years of data; in 1993 it was Palau ahead.
Azerbaijan ranks 92nd and Palau ranks 90th of 184 countries.
Palau has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

About this data
Printing and writing papers — Import quantity div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
